Latest invitation rounds

Subclass 189

invited at 75 pts on 13 November 2025

down from 80 pts · ~73 invitations issued · cut-off range 65–80 over the past 6 rounds · 2 rounds so far in FY25-26 · trend easing

Subclass 190

invited at 80 pts on 5 March 2026

down from 85 pts · 4 rounds so far in FY25-26 · trend stable

Subclass 491

invited at 90 pts on 13 November 2025

up from 75 pts · ~2 invitations issued · 1 round so far in FY25-26 · trend rising

Key Insights for Medical Practitioners nec

  • Points are stable. The minimum invited score has remained consistent over recent rounds. Expect similar thresholds in the near future.

  • Still 25 points above the legal minimum. Despite current trends, Medical Practitioners nec remains competitive. Applicants significantly below 90 points are unlikely to receive invitations soon.

  • 7 rounds so far in FY25-26. Medical Practitioners nec has been included in 7 invitation rounds this financial year. More rounds generally indicate sustained demand from the Department.
